Transaction 5896629fd4e6410974419f2b48fd6c8db0725afecde8753bfc87868cef05da2c

1 Input
2 Outputs
  • 5896629fd4e6410974419f2b48fd6c8db0725afecde8753bfc87868cef05da2c:0
  • value  4660381
    address  18kFW6h5PnmV5UrZdi1vGkkqQ3uK3MzCpm
  • 5896629fd4e6410974419f2b48fd6c8db0725afecde8753bfc87868cef05da2c:1
  • value  3730783
    address  3LGc3ShaLpvix4QFEipEerfL7gWDnb8J7n